Mickey Arthur, Grant Bradburn, and Andrew Puttick Resign from Pakistan Cricket

Mickey Arthur was director of Pakistan cricket.

Mickey Arthur, Grant Bradburn, and Andrew Puttick step down from their respective roles at the National Cricket Academy after being demoted by the PCB due to the men’s team performance in the ICC World Cup 2023.

Formerly, Arthur served as the director of Pakistan cricket, with Bradburn as the head coach and Puttick as the batting coach, prior to their reassignments to the NCA.

“All three individuals informed the Pakistan Cricket Board of their decision to leave their respective jobs by the end of January 2024.”

“The decision was taken amicably between all the stakeholders. The PCB wishes them well in their future endeavours and is grateful for their services,” the PCB said in a statement.
